Standard Self-improvement advice is usually beige, unhelpful and often just wrong.
We dive into the topic of "You are the 5 people you spend most time with" and learn where it is wrong and dangerous to follow. Instead, we learn a toolkit to be ourselves wherever we are and build relationships that nourish us.
Lessons:
Where common advice falls short
Signs of toxic relationships blocking you from your potential
Signs of healthy relationships
Using the Growth Mindset to control your influences and outcomes
Seeking variety from your inputs
The dangers of conforming and group-think
This episode holds a core mental-model for building a Growth Mindset and how to seek inspiration around you. Avoid getting caught in group-think or relationships that create Fixed Mindset thinking and be more yourself.

Questions to reflect on
What are my strengths? When do I feel like I am being myself?
I am putting my energy directly into the thing I want to do or is it postponed for some reason?
Is there a faster way to reach the lifestyle I want?
Who are my idols? Why do I look up to them? Could I have better idols?
Who are 5 cool but very different friends to me, what would they tell me to do?
